Resume

This study evaluates tissue-level pathological changes in traumatic brain injury through histomorphological analysis of 35 autopsy cases. Key staining techniques (H&E, LFB, Nissl, PAS, and Perl’s) were applied to assess ischemia, demyelination, neuronal damage, and microhemorrhage. Results indicate strong clinical relevance between microscopic findings and imaging-based diagnostics. The study supports histological stains as essential tools in identifying functional brain injury and guiding neurotrauma prognosis
